SQLServer2008存储过程调试T-SQLDEBUGGER概述

我们今天主要向大家讲述的是SQL Server2008存储过程调试 T-SQL DEBUGGER的实际操作流程,SQL Server 2005数据库中不知是什么原因去掉了很重要的DEBUGGER功能,要调试,必须要安装VS2005专业版或者更高版本。非常不方便。

创新互联建站专注于通江企业网站建设,响应式网站,商城系统网站开发。通江网站建设公司,为通江等地区提供建站服务。全流程按需规划网站,专业设计,全程项目跟踪,创新互联建站专业和态度为您提供的服务

还好,SQL Server 2008中这个很重要而且方便的功能又回来了。

不过,SQL Server 2008存储过程调试功能和SQL2000的方法差别很大。SQL2000是在查询分析器中的对象浏览器中选中需要调试的存储过程,右键----调试---输入参数开始调试。

SQL Server2008中则完全不同,变成了必须要在SSMS中EXEC [PROCEDURE NAME] @VAR1,@VAR2,然后点绿色三角或者点菜单中的调试---启动调试。然后点工具栏的最右边的单步调试或者跳出等。下面的变量窗口和堆栈窗口等可以查看调试中变量等动态变化值。

SQL Server2008调试的要求和条件:如果在引擎所在的电脑或服务器上调试,则只需要SA或者WINDOWS用户登陆即可。如果是异地调试,则需要设置防火墙例外,增加SSMS和SQL Server.EXE为允许,增加135端口允许通过。

SQL Server2008存储过程调试的限制:使用调试功能不能在开启windows 纤程的机器上执行。也就是WINDOWS轻量池 LIGHT SPOOL不能开启。

暂时先想起来这么多,以后再添加。总之,SQL2008的调试比2000操作起来麻烦多了,要求也多了。感觉不如2000的好用,也可能是2000用习惯了。

文章标题:SQLServer2008存储过程调试T-SQLDEBUGGER概述
文章位置:http://www.shufengxianlan.com/qtweb/news2/309302.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联